From the minute you turn onto the long, private driveway, the view is breathtaking. In addition to the 3 bedroom, plus office, 2 bathroom manufactured home, there is an unfinished room above the garage with a bathroom already installed. The home interior is in excellent condition, but the home could be classified as a fixer-upper due to the unfinished garage and condition of the outside deck. This home and beautiful property is best suited for a cash buyer. Property line starts just past the Sunshine Apartments and comes all the way up to the house. Property is cross-fenced. There is a huge shop that needs work with its own well, septic and electric. This is a unique find with all of this property, yet only 10 minutes to Roseburg!

Exclusive Farm Use-Grazing Zone
The purpose and intent of the Exclusive Farm Use-Grazing zone is to provide areas for the continued practice of agriculture and permit the establishment of only those new uses which are compatible with agricultural activities. The minimum property size established by this zone is intended to promote commercial agricultural pursuits, such as grazing, rangeland and other less intensive agricultural uses.; It is the purpose of this zone classification to provide the automatic farm use valuation for farms which automatically qualify under the provisions of ORS 308. Therefore, the Exclusive Farm Use Zone is to be applied to all lands designated Agriculture in the Comprehensive Plan in accordance with LCDC Goal No. 3 and the Douglas County Agricultural Element. ; The Exclusive Farm Use Zone is intended to guarantee the preservation and maintenance of the areas so classified for farm use free from conflicting nonfarm uses and influences
